Abstract

This paper describes an automatic approach to the determination of plastic collapse loads for plane frames using the kinematic method. An algorithm is developed to determine the elementary collapse mechanisms for an arbitrary frame. These mechanisms are then combined in a systematic manner using a recursive algorithm in order to find the mechanism with the lowest collapse load. Since all potential collapse mechanisms are investigated, the method is able to find alternative collapse mechanisms with the same load factor, and indeed the lowest n collapse mechanisms. The approach is applied to three examples, and is shown to be accurate and capable of practical application. A complete C++ program listing is included.
